Natural Gas Inventories as of May 2, 2025
The EIA has released its natural gas inventory report, showing a net increase of 104 Bcf as of May 2, 2025.
Working gas in storage was 2,145 Bcf as of Friday, May 2, 2025, according to EIA estimates. This represents a net increase of 104 Bcf from the previous week. Stocks were 412 Bcf less than last year at this time and 30 Bcf below the five-year average of 2,115 Bcf.
At 2,145 Bcf, total working gas is within the five-year historical range.

All regions experienced a net increase.
All regions, except for the Mountain and Pacific, and South Central Salt are below the five-year average.
